2.2.3.5.13 AssociationGroupId

The AssociationGroupId command specifies the client association group ID. The client association group ID is an RTS cookie that the higher layer protocol MAY use to uniquely identify instances of this client across multiple virtual connections. Implementations of this protocol MAY use this cookie as part of load balancing logic. Regardless of who sends this PDU, the association group ID MUST be interpreted to be that of the client.

CommandType (4 bytes):  MUST be the value AssociationGroupId (0x0000000C).

AssociationGroupId (16 bytes): MUST be encoded as an RTS cookie that the client generated for this association as explained in this section. It is encoded as defined in section 2.2.3.1.
